In the quest for better health and well-being, a new study has shed light on an often-overlooked aspect of our daily lives: the impact of light on our sleep patterns. The research, led by scientists at the University of Manchester, reveals that brighter and more consistent daytime light exposure can lead to earlier bedtimes, improved sleep quality, and deeper rest. The study involved 89 adults who wore light sensors and sleep trackers, providing over 500 days of data. The findings were striking: people who spent more time in brighter daytime light tended to fall asleep earlier and wake up earlier. Additionally, those with steadier light patterns across the week had healthier sleep timing, and those with more regular light exposure experienced stronger deep sleep, which is crucial for memory, recovery, and overall health.
One thing that immediately stands out is the contrast between modern indoor lighting and natural daylight. Most people spend their days in dimmer lighting than natural daylight and their evenings in brighter lighting than their bodies expect. This mismatch has been linked to chronic health problems and higher mortality risk, which is why the study's findings are so significant. It suggests that simple changes in our daily light exposure habits could have a meaningful impact on our sleep health.
What many people don't realize is that light exposure is not just about the amount of light we're exposed to, but also about the consistency of that light. Chaotic patterns of dim and bright light can disrupt our internal rhythms, leading to poorer sleep quality. By keeping light exposure stable and avoiding these chaotic patterns, we may be able to strengthen our body's internal rhythms and improve our sleep.
